Cedar Point Campground has clean campsites and bath facilities. The area provides shade and privacy. It is quiet and pleasant. We enjoyed our two week stay very much.

Nice little campground just a couple miles from Emerald Isle Beach. Sites are roomy, shady, and well maintained. We had pull-through site 20 which is described in Rec.gov as sharing a picnic table with site 19 but it does not. Sites are electric only but there are water spigots at several points along the CG loop as well as a fill at the dump station. Camp Host Robbie was very friendly and helpful and aware of all activity within the CG. Restrooms are clean. If our travels take us back to the coast of NC we will certainly stay here again.

Campground was kept very clean. Saw camp host ride bike around checking everything multiple times a day. Bathhouse was functional and showers were hot. Short walk to hiking trail that was well kept.

Location Cedar Point Campground
Address:
391 Vfw Road
Cedar Point, NC, 28584
United States
Take VFW Road off NC 58 approximately 1.25 miles north of the junction of NC 24 and NC 58. Follow signs to the campground on VFW Road.
Latitude & Longitude: 34.6931 / -77.0822
Elevation: 5 feet

Because of its proximity to the coast, Cedar Point is sometimes impacted by hurricanes and tropical storms and must be closed temporarily. These storms generally occur from July through September. It is always wise to check the weather forecast prior to your arrival, particularly during these months. |
